
Johnny Libertella
Synopsis
At 60 years old, Johnny Libertella has lived his entire life in the Rosemont–La Petite-Patrie district. Like his parents before him, he lives just above his business on Plaza St-Hubert. This introvert has chosen to devote himself body and soul to his business. For more than three decades, he has stood religiously behind the counter of his boutique specializing in cowboy boots and only ventures outside the Plaza to see his only daughter every Sunday. This seemingly gloomy way of life nevertheless symbolizes happiness in Johnny's eyes: the freedom to lead an existence imbued with wisdom and humility where he can open up to the world in the comfort of his shop. His passion for sales is his way of opening up to life.
